  • In tonight’s tops tory: Countries at the COP28 conference have agreed to "transition away" from fossil fuels. The deal is billed as historic, but critics say it falls short of what needs to be done to avert the climate crisis. Heather Yourex-West reports on the details of the agreement and the wide range of reactions.
    Over in the Middle East, Israel's war on Hamas has displaced nearly everybody in the Gaza Strip, where essential supplies and safe spaces are harder to find. Crystal Goomansingh looks at how the weather is making displacement camps even more intolerable and the growing uncertainty of the solution to Gaza's dire humanitarian crisis.
    And, Canada's decision to vote in favour of a United Nations resolution calling for an immediate humanitarian ceasefire in the Israel-Hamas conflict and the unconditional release of all hostages is being both praised and condemned. David Akin explains how this has created new divisions within the federal Liberal caucus and why some members are not worried.
    Plus, True North Sports and Entertainment - the company that owns the Winnipeg Jets - and 34 First Nations are collaborating on a plan to revitalize Winnipeg's downtown core. Melissa Ridgen explains what will happen to the former Hudson's Bay Company building, the nearly empty Portage Place shopping mall and when the project is set to be complete.
    Over on Canada’s east coast, Dr. Gerges Ambarak is calling out racism in Newfoundland and Labrador's school system, after his daughter was attacked. Heidi Petracek explains how Dr. Ambarak's viral online post has sparked calls for action and a flood of support for him and his family.
    And, when Palestinians need to be transported to hospitals in Israel, they often get help from Israeli volunteers through the charity Road to Recovery. While the organization no longer operates in the Gaza Strip, due to Israel's war on Hamas, it is still helping Palestinians in the West Bank. Daniele Hamamdjian spoke with some Road to Recovery members to learn what drives them to keep going.
